Deep bed water treatment media system offer exceptional performance in systems with high levels of fine particulate matter. Their extended media depth captures smaller particles that standard filters might miss. This makes them particularly useful in pre-treatment setups before membrane filtration, helping prolong membrane lifespan and reduce fouling.
Multi-media filters enhance filtration performance by layering different media types—typically gravel, sand, and anthracite—from coarse to fine. This gradient traps particles of varying sizes more effectively and reduces pressure loss. water treatment media system with this structure are ideal for complex filtration tasks in chemical plants and large-scale water systems.
Q: What are the primary components of Media filter? A: Media filter consist mainly of a filtration tank, a layered media bed typically made of sand and anthracite, an inlet and outlet for water flow, and a backwash system to clean the media and maintain filter efficiency. Q: How does backwashing improve the functionality of Media filter? A: Backwashing reverses water flow through the filter, flushing out trapped particles from the media bed. This process restores the filter’s permeability and prevents clogging, ensuring consistent water flow and filtration quality. Q: Can Media filter be used for industrial water treatment? A: Yes, Media filter are versatile and widely used in treating irrigation water, and various industrial process waters to remove suspended solids and improve overall water quality. Q: What factors affect the lifespan of Media filter? A: Factors include water quality, frequency of backwashing, media type and quality, and operational parameters like flow rate and pressure. Proper maintenance extends the service life significantly. Q: Are there limitations to the particle size that Media filter can filter? A: While Media filter are effective at removing most suspended solids, their filtration is generally limited to particles larger than approximately 20 microns, meaning very fine particles and dissolved substances may require additional treatment methods.
